I was delighted with my consultation, HOWEVER it might be good if patients having mydriatic eye drops were advised to bring a pair of dark glasses to wear post consultation.
I made my own way to the appointment on public transport, on the way home I really struggled with bright sunlight flooding my field of vision.
A most uncomfortable feeling causing my eyes to water profusely diminishing my sight even more.
Such a small thing but would have helped me enormously if I had been wearing dark glasses.
